Oliver Jonas "Ollie" Queen is a male Human who lives in the 24th century (born May 16, 2351) is a former playboy-turned-vigilante archer on Earth Fifty. He was also the previous owner of the night club Verdant (which he used as a cover for his operations) and CEO of Queen Consolidated. After being presumed lost at sea for 5 years Oliver returned home with a mission to rid Starling City of crime and corruption, becoming the hooded vigilante known as The Hood. Armed with a bow and arrow, The Hood was willing to use lethal force, but after his best friend Tommy Merlyn was killed in the Undertaking, Oliver vowed never to kill again unless absolutely necessary, renaming himself The Arrow. After his maternal half-sister Thea was nearly killed, Oliver pretended to accept Ra's al Ghul's invitation to become his heir in exchange for Ra's saving Thea's life. He earned the titles Al Sah-him (Arabic: السهم; for Arrow) and Warith al Ghul (Arabic: وريث الغول; for Heir to the Demon). He further earned the title Ibn al Ghul (Arabic: ابن الغول; for Son of the Demon) when Ra's forced Oliver and Nyssa to marry. Eventually, Oliver defeated Ra's, inheriting the title of Ra's al Ghul (Arabic: رأس الغول‎; for Demon's Head), before passing on the leadership of the League of Assassins to Malcolm Merlyn. He briefly retired from vigilantism soon after and left his city to begin a new life with Felicity Smoak, but returned five months later due to H.I.V.E.'s rise, taking up the new code-name Green Arrow, stylized as the "Emerald Archer". During his time in Solntsevskaya Bratva division in Krasnoyarsk he was nicknamed Kapot (Russian: капот; for car hood), while in Russia he is called Luchnik (Russian: лучник; for archer) or Kapiushon (Russian: Капюшон; for hood).
